// The pk-devimport command runs an importer, using the importer code linked into the binary,
// against a Perkeep server. This enables easier interactive development of importers,
// without having to restart a server.
package main
import (
"errors"
"flag"
"fmt"
"log"
"net/url"
"os"
"camlistore.org/pkg/blob"
"camlistore.org/pkg/client"
"camlistore.org/pkg/importer"
"camlistore.org/pkg/osutil"
"camlistore.org/pkg/search"
_ "camlistore.org/pkg/importer/allimporters"
)
const serverFlagHelp = "Format is is either a URL prefix (with optional path), a host[:port], a config file server alias, or blank to use the Camlistore client config's default server."
// newClient returns a Perkeep client for the server.
// The server may be:
// * blank, to use the default in the config file
// * an alias, to use that named alias in the config file
// * host:port
// * https?://host[:port][/path]
func newClient(server string, opts ...client.ClientOption) *client.Client {
if server == "" {
return client.NewOrFail(opts...)
}
cl := client.New(server, opts...)
if err := cl.SetupAuth(); err != nil {
log.Fatalf("Could not setup auth for connecting to %v: %v", server, err)
}
return cl
}
var (
flagServer = flag.String("server", "", "Server to search. "+serverFlagHelp)
)
func usage() {
fmt.Fprintf(os.Stderr,
`Usage: pk-devimport <importerType> <accountNodeRef>
-importerType is one of the supported importers: feed, flickr, foursquare, gphotos, pinboard, plaid, twitter.
-accountNodeRef is the permanode of camliNodeType importerAccount representing the account to import.
`)
}
func newImporterHost(server string, importerType string) (*importer.Host, error) {
cl := newClient(server)
// To avoid the ExplicitSecretRingFile panic when setting up the signer.
osutil.AddSecretRingFlag()
signer, err := cl.Signer()
if err != nil {
return nil, err
}
// TODO(mpl): technically not true, but works for now.
baseURL, err := cl.BlobRoot()
if err != nil {
return nil, err
}
clientID, clientSecret, err := getCredentials(cl, importerType)
if err != nil {
return nil, err
}
hc := importer.HostConfig{
BaseURL: baseURL,
Prefix: "/importer/", // TODO(mpl): do not hardcode this prefix
Target: cl,
BlobSource: cl,
Signer: signer,
Search: cl,
ClientId: map[string]string{
importerType: clientID,
},
ClientSecret: map[string]string{
importerType: clientSecret,
},
}
return importer.NewHost(hc)
}
// getCredentials returns the OAuth clientID and clientSecret found in the
// importer node of the given importerType.
func getCredentials(sh search.QueryDescriber, importerType string) (string, string, error) {
var clientID, clientSecret string
res, err := sh.Query(&search.SearchQuery{
Expression: "attr:camliNodeType:importer and attr:importerType:" + importerType,
Describe: &search.DescribeRequest{
Depth: 1,
},
})
if err != nil {
return clientID, clientSecret, err
}
if res.Describe == nil {
return clientID, clientSecret, errors.New("no importer node found")
}
var attrs url.Values
for _, resBlob := range res.Blobs {
blob := resBlob.Blob
desBlob, ok := res.Describe.Meta[blob.String()]
if !ok || desBlob.Permanode == nil {
continue
}
attrs = desBlob.Permanode.Attr
if attrs.Get("camliNodeType") != "importer" {
return clientID, clientSecret, errors.New("search result returned non importer node")
}
if t := attrs.Get("importerType"); t != importerType {
return clientID, clientSecret, fmt.Errorf("search result returned importer node of the wrong type: %v", t)
}
break
}
attrClientID, attrClientSecret := "authClientID", "authClientSecret"
attr := attrs[attrClientID]
if len(attr) != 1 {
return clientID, clientSecret, fmt.Errorf("no %v attribute", attrClientID)
}
clientID = attr[0]
attr = attrs[attrClientSecret]
if len(attr) != 1 {
return clientID, clientSecret, fmt.Errorf("no %v attribute", attrClientSecret)
}
clientSecret = attr[0]
return clientID, clientSecret, nil
}
func main() {
flag.Parse()
args := flag.Args()
if len(args) != 2 {
usage()
os.Exit(2)
}
if _, ok := importer.All()[args[0]]; !ok {
log.Fatalf("%v is not a valid importer name", args[0])
}
ref, ok := blob.Parse(args[1])
if !ok {
log.Fatalf("Not a valid blob ref: %q", args[1])
}
h, err := newImporterHost(*flagServer, args[0])
if err != nil {
log.Fatal(err)
}
if err := h.RunImporterAccount(args[0], ref); err != nil {
log.Fatal(err)
}
}

// RunImporterAccount runs the importerType importer on the account described in
// accountNode.
func (h *Host) RunImporterAccount(importerType string, accountNode blob.Ref) error {
h.didInit.Wait()
imp, ok := h.imp[importerType]
if !ok {
return fmt.Errorf("no %q importer for this account", importerType)
}
accounts, err := imp.Accounts()
if err != nil {
return err
}
for _, ia := range accounts {
if ia.acct.pn != accountNode {
continue
}
return ia.run()
}
return fmt.Errorf("no %v account matching account in node %v", importerType, accountNode)
}
